## Session Handling: Checkout Load Tests (Brindlecart)

Welcome aboard! When you run load tests against the Brindlecart checkout, each virtual user needs its own session — don't share cookies between workers or the rate limiter will flag you. Sessions live 30 minutes; our scripts refresh them at 25. Keep concurrency under 500 on staging unless you've pinged the platform crew first. The harness authenticates every request to the checkout gateway using the bearer token below.

session JWT of yawep-yawep = eyJhbGciOiJIUzI1NiIsInR5cCI6IkpXVCJ9.eyJzdWIiOiI3pWF3_In0.aXYsHiog

# Annual Billing Transition (Managers Only)

Effective next fiscal year, Quillbrook subscriptions move to annual billing by default. Monthly plans remain for legacy Marven accounts only. Finance owns invoice migration; deadline end of Q2. Expect a one-time deferred revenue bump of roughly 9%. Dunning rules unchanged. Escalate disputes to the Revenue Desk. Do not communicate externally until the announcement clears review. The confidential planning note below applies to this transition.

board note of kageg-bahof: The renewal with Holwynax Holdings closes at $2 million a year, 5 percent below the last contract. Project Ulaath slips by two quarters because of the supplier delay.

Subject: Quickstore 4.2 — bloom filter now fronts the KV layer

Plugin authors: starting with this release, Quickstore places a bloom filter ahead of the key-value store. Negative lookups return faster; false positives fall through safely. No API changes are required on your side. Verify your plugin against the staging build referenced below.

session token of fahif-tadup = htk3_9c7